Output e67fe8c9626ff3610476eb5e637ee4974046181cad0d020d7877087a38b0a414: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17647c7d0bad65b01fe15b0f0e4733cc01084dc OP_EQUAL
address
3LnYquGpdkF41PVJeAWU1mW4KDZqRpfBhd
transaction
e67fe8c9626ff3610476eb5e637ee4974046181cad0d020d7877087a38b0a414
confirmations
383543
spent
true